A1190LUA-T's Overview

The A1190LUA-T is a Unipolar Hall Effect Sensor, designed for versatility with operating voltages ranging from 3.3V to 24V. In simple terms, it's a magnetic sensor that detects changes in magnetic fields, making it an indispensable component in electronic devices requiring precision and accuracy.


Key Features:

· The A1190LUA-T's unipolar design ensures unparalleled accuracy by responding exclusively to a single magnetic pole.

· With an extensive operating voltage range from 3.3V to 24V, this sensor seamlessly integrates into diverse electronic systems.

· Packed into an Ultra Mini SIP, this 3-pin sensor saves valuable PCB space without compromising functionality.

· Operating between -40°C to 150°C, the A1190LUA-T thrives in extreme conditions, earning its automotive-grade stripes.


Specifications:

Type

Parameter

Magnetic Type

Unipolar

Module/IC Classification

IC

Typical Magnetic Sensor Hysteresis (Gs)

30(Max)

Maximum Magnetic Sensor Operating Point (Gs)

200

Typical Output Fall Time (us)

100(Max)

Minimum Operating Supply Voltage (V)

3

Typical Operating Supply Voltage (V)

3.3|5|9|12|15|18

Maximum Operating Supply Voltage (V)

24

Maximum Supply Current (uA)

5000

Minimum Operating Temperature (°C)

-40

Maximum Operating Temperature (°C)

150

Supplier Temperature Grade

Automotive

Packaging

Bulk

Mounting

Through Hole

Package Height

3.02

Package Width

1.52

Package Length

4.09

PCB changed

3

Standard Package Name

SIP

Supplier Package

Ultra Mini SIP

Pin Count

3

Lead Shape

Through Hole

A1190LUA-T's Manufacturer:

Allegro MicroSystems is a global semiconductor leader in sensor and power integrated circuits (ICs) and photonics. With more than 30 years of experience developing advanced semiconductor technology and application-specific algorithms, Allegro designs, develops, manufactures, and markets analog and mixed-signal semiconductors. The Company offers magnetic sensor integrated circuits (ICs), dual element switches, micropower switches, single output drivers, and LED drivers.
